ABOUT US 

ProctorExam is a fast-growing education-tech startup based in Amsterdam, and we are changing the world of e-learning by developing software that identifies exam takers behind the computer and creates cheating proof environments for online exams. We believe online education is the key to revolutionizing learning. The ProctorExam software combines screen sharing, use of the webcam, and the camera on a mobile device to create a 360 degree secure environment so that students can take their exams anywhere, anytime.
